Which of the following decreases when an object is moved using an inclined plane? Select one:the distance the object moveshighlight_offthe amount of space the object occupieshighlight_offthe force needed to move the objecthighlight_offthe pull of gravity on the objecthighlight_off
Solution
The force needed to move the object decreases when an object is moved using an inclined plane. This is because an inclined plane, which is a type of simple machine, reduces the amount of force needed to move an object upward by increasing the distance over which that force is applied.
